When the president issues an ‘ordinance’, at a time when we have a working parliament, to transfer powers from NAB to Law Minister, somebody has to take things up:

Accountability Ordinance promulgated ‘secretly’

The National Accountability (Amendment) Ordinance of 2010 was promulgated in a clandestine manner, as not only the legal community and the nation were unaware but the top officials in the Law Ministry also knew nothing about it.

Law Secretary Masood Chishti while talking to TheNation expressed his complete ignorance and said, “I don’t know any such Ordinance has ever been issued.” He, however, said that the Ordinance was promulgated when the National Assembly and the Senate were not in sessions. “The President is only allowed to issue the Ordinance when there was no session of the Parliament,” he said.

The indecent haste shrouded in secrecy with which powers of NAB Chairman, who is yet to be appointed after consultation with the Leader of the Opposition in the National Assembly, have been transferred to the Law Minister may lend credence to the view that the Government is not serious about accountability…*

The supreme court ordered an independent person to be appointed Chairman NAB… the government asked for a few days’ extension for ‘consultation’… the above ordinance is the result of that ‘consultation’.
